In terms of gameplay, this title represents the pinnacle of SEGA's experimental spirit. For the most part, it plays like a side-scrolling beat 'em up similar to Golden Axe, where players use stun rods, flamethrowers, or lasers for melee and ranged attacks. However, upon entering specific buildings or areas, the perspective instantly switches to a first-person shooter mode, requiring players to quickly eliminate a screen full of aliens, much like in Operation Wolf.
The character designs are full of personality: Karen is highly mobile, Gordon packs heavy firepower, and the robot Scooter can even self-destruct for a screen-clearing attack. Visually, the gooey explosions and exaggerated transformations of defeated aliens showcase SEGA's mastery of 2D pixel art. Its dynamic soundtrack perfectly matches the rhythm of combat, and even by today's standards, its hybrid gameplay remains incredibly fun.
